A small update, version 9.4.2.28, is being pushed out OTA to the Transformer Prime. This update brings with it a few things, including a GPS dongle fix, support for Bluetooth HDP, a "third party app upgrade," and other bug fixes. The best feature change that we can see with this update is the ability to use Android 4.0′s Face Unlock. So far, this update has only rolled out in the UK, but should be coming to U.S. customer fairly soon as well. Sound off when you start to get yours.
